What Zep said about the ult thing is true, you don't just drop it in the middle of a lane, you try and get your team to bring the fight to an opimal location. Like along the sides of the river where it's really narrow and you can only go back or forwards. Traps them in there longer, and if they run back they leave teammates, if they run forwards they run into you.
GP's ult really is amazing when it's used properly with a good team
